News: 0001553697

  ARM Give a man a fire and he's warm for a day, but set fire to him and he's warm for the rest of his life (Terry Pratchett, Jingo)

Dbus-Broker 37 Released For High Performance & Reliable D-Bus

([Free Software] 6 Hours Ago Dbus-Broker 37)


The Dbus-Broker project from the BUS1/systemd developers is out with its first update in more than one year for this D-Bus implementation that aims to be more reliable and higher performing than D-Bus itself.

While this is the first Dbus-Broker release since April 2024, it's not too exciting with this open-source message broker being rather mature at this stage. The release highlights of the new Dbus-Broker 37 include:

"* Add `/etc` and `/run` to the search-paths for system services. This change is aligned with recent changes to the reference implementation.

* Support systemd's `notify-reload` to trigger a reload operation. This replaces the old `busctl call ...ReloadConfig` operation.

* Extend `org.freedesktop.DBus.Debug.Stats.GetStats` with all the fields defined by the specification.

* Fix a bug in match-rule processing which caused argument processing to fail for any but the first message argument.

* Fix a memory leak in configuration processing when parsing invalid user or group IDs."

Downloads and more details on the Dbus-Broker 37 release via [1]GitHub .



[1] https://github.com/bus1/dbus-broker/releases/tag/v37



phoronix

My own dear love, he is strong and bold
And he cares not what comes after.
His words ring sweet as a chime of gold,
And his eyes are lit with laughter.
He is jubilant as a flag unfurled --
Oh, a girl, she'd not forget him.
My own dear love, he is all my world --
And I wish I'd never met him.
-- Dorothy Parker, part 1